My one Yellow has a brushless nozzle and the other one had none so, Necessity being the Mother of all Inventors, I adapted a nameless floor tool nozzle from The Bin Of Orphans with a wrap-a-round brush to fit. Works great but it just not the real thing, ya know.
All that was needed was a short length of rubber hose to create a collar to rotate on the machine. That's where Player Piano hose stock comes in handy.
The business end duplicates the intention of the Floor Washer's brushplate. The inner channel rim is set back 1/8" above the brush. Sealed off the upper 'gleaner' slot.
